5.0 out of 5 stars Unusually accurate cartoon-style Bible story book;, June 30, 1998
This review is from: Read-n-grow Picture Bible: Adventure from Creation to Revelation in 1,872 Realistic Pictures (Hardcover)
This is the only illustrated Bible story book that I have ever seen, that I can really recommend. Comparing the stories to a simple-English-language Bible reveals a careful attention to detail and significance in what is necessarily an abbreviated story. This alone is almost unique. The careful consideration of age- appropriate language is still unusual enough to be noteworthy. But the pictures!

I could count the anachronisms I have caught on the fingers of one hand. In most picture Bibles, this score is exceeded before the third page. But every detail seems to have been carefully researched: clothing, weapons, architecture, technology, are all taken from contemporary evidence. Most books just draw the people in robes. Not this one! Goliath wears armor and headdress right off Merenptah's pictures of the Sea Peoples. Israelite robes, Roman togas, Persian headgear, are all carefully distinguished. Even the geography is carefully represented. I highly recommend this book as the second resource (after an appropriate Bible translation such as NCB/ICB) for anyone teaching 4-10 year olds.

5.0 out of 5 stars The best picture Bible for all ages! But racial depictions are off., October 26, 2010
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: Read-n-grow Picture Bible: Adventure from Creation to Revelation in 1,872 Realistic Pictures (Hardcover)
This Bible does a very thorough job of not only telling but portraying key Bible stories. If you are a visual learner this is excellent due to the comic book format. Yet the telling of each story remains rich. It is of course in chronological order and when needed the next story recaps the previous. For adults that aren't familiar with the flow of Bible history and the significance of how the Old Testament stories tie into the New Testament this picture Bible will get you up to speed on the basics. This is relatively minor but one thing that bothered me was the racial portrayal of characters as predominantly white. One of the few darker skinned characters in the picture Bible is a servant go figure. Even Bible scientists/historians have long understood that most of the people, if any were not Anglo Saxon. This Picture Bible is still worth having because the Word of God is far more important than any of our shades of color. I've bought a few of these to give away and we use it in our daycare and at church. Buy and be blessed!
